Countertop projects in Tustin come with their own set of challenges and considerations. For instance, older homes may feature non-standard cabinet dimensions or require reinforcement to support heavy stone materials like granite or quartzite. Outdoor kitchens, which are popular in Tustin’s sunny climate, demand UV-stable materials such as porcelain or Dekton to withstand prolonged exposure. Additionally, compliance with local regulations, including permits from the City of Tustin Building Department, is essential for ensuring proper appliance clearances, venting, and structural bracing during installation.

When it comes to costs, quartz or granite countertop installations in Tustin typically range from $70 to $150 per square foot, depending on the material, edge finishes, and whether old surfaces need removal. The cost of countertop installations can vary significantly depending on the material, size, and complexity of the project. Nationwide, the average cost typically ranges from $2,000 to $4,500 for materials like granite and quartz. Budget-friendly options like laminate can cost as little as $1,200, while high-end materials like marble or rare stone may exceed $7,500. These prices generally include both materials and labor. The timeline for countertop installation can vary based on factors like material selection, complexity of design, and area preparation. Typically, the process includes:

  1. Consultation and Measurement: 1–2 days.
  2. Material Fabrication: 7–14 days.
  3. Installation: 1–2 days.

Depending on material availability and project scope, the entire process can take anywhere from 2 to 4 weeks. During your consultation with "Countertop Pros," you'll receive a detailed timeline based on your unique project.

Watch out for these red flags when hiring countertop installers:

  • Unlicensed or uninsured contractors: This puts your property and finances at risk.
  • Excessively low bids: Could mean subpar materials or unexpected additional costs.
  • Lack of references or customer reviews: Reliable professionals will provide proof of past successes.
  • Pressure to sign immediately: High-quality contractors will let you take time to consider.
  • Unclear contracts or hidden fees: Ensure all terms are written and transparent.

To ensure a smooth installation process, follow these preparation steps:

  1. Remove items from your countertops: All appliances, utensils, and decor.
  2. Empty cabinets and drawers: Especially those directly below or near countertops.
  3. Clear a path: Ensure installers have easy access to the work area.
  4. Verify details: Double-check material choices and measurements with "Countertop Pros."

Taking these steps will save time and help installers focus on delivering quality results.
